7ebcd8891a
All uses of JSONGenerator in debugserver would create a JSON text dump of the object collection, then copy that string into a binary-escaped string, then send it up to the lldb side or make a compressed version and send that. This adds a DumpBinaryEscaped method to JSONGenerator which does the gdb remote serial protocol binary escaping directly, and removes the need to pass over the string and have an additional copy in memory. Differential Revision: https://reviews.llvm.org/D122882 rdar://91117456 |
||
---|---|---|
.. | ||
argdumper | ||
compact-unwind | ||
darwin-debug | ||
darwin-threads | ||
debugserver | ||
driver | ||
intel-features | ||
lldb-fuzzer | ||
lldb-instr | ||
lldb-server | ||
lldb-test | ||
lldb-vscode | ||
CMakeLists.txt |